What's Happening?
Citi has introduced two premium credit cards, the Citi Strata Elite and Citi Strata Premier, as part of its ThankYou points ecosystem. The Citi Strata Elite Card has a $595 annual fee and offers perks like lounge access and bonus points on travel and dining.
The Citi Strata Premier Card has a $95 annual fee and provides bonus points on dining, gas, and travel. Both cards offer significant welcome bonuses and allow users to transfer points to airline and hotel partners, enhancing the value of the Citi Double Cash Card.
